Exploring Pet-Friendly Living in Warrenton, MO: A Dog and Cat Owner's Guide

Nestled in the heart of Missouri, Warrenton blends small-town charm with a burgeoning array of amenities, making it an appealing prospect for families with four-legged companions. Whether you're a dog lover or a cat aficionado, understanding the quality of life that Warrenton offers for your pets is crucial before making the move. Let’s delve into what you can expect in this quaint city.

Warrenton may be small, but it packs a punch when it comes to pet-friendly amenities and services. For pet owners who prioritize a healthy and happy life for their furry friends, several factors come into play, such as training opportunities, vet services, outdoor spaces, and more.


Training Opportunities: Building Better Behaved Pets

One of the most crucial aspects of pet parenting is training your pet. In Warrenton, you have access to a handful of excellent training facilities. The Warrenton Dog Club offers group classes and one-on-one sessions, which range from basic obedience to advanced agility training. For cat owners, while traditional training classes are less common, several local trainers provide bespoke behavioral consultancy, guiding you through house training and socialization techniques suited for felines.

Veterinary Services: A Lifeline for Pet Health

Warrenton is well-served by veterinary clinics that offer comprehensive care for both dogs and cats. Warrenton Animal Clinic is a popular choice, renowned for its state-of-the-art facilities including emergency care and specialized treatments. For more specific services, such as dentistry or surgical procedures, you might have to travel a bit farther, with institutions like the University of Missouri Veterinary Health Center in Columbia being commendable options.

Outdoor Spaces: Fun and Freedom

Outdoor activities play a significant role in your pet's life, particularly for dogs who need their daily dose of exercise. Warrenton Park is well-loved for its dog-friendly areas where pets can roam off-leash under supervision. The city also boasts walking trails such as those around the Schroeder State Park, offering a serene environment for both dog walks and mildly adventurous cat outings on a leash.

Housing: Finding the Perfect Home

Securing pet-friendly housing in Warrenton is straightforward, although options tend to vary. Most rental properties require a pet deposit, and some landlords have restrictions on the size or breed of dogs. Apartment complexes such as Warrenton Manor Apartments welcome pets, offering ample space for them to play. Homebuyers will find a range of properties, from compact townhouses to spacious family homes, many of which have fenced yards ideal for pets.
